1 (19.01.2013 19:09:25 отредактировано LabelZero)

Сообщение при сборке одного порта:
"Variable CFLAGS is recursive"
CFLAGS в make.conf:

CFLAGS=-O3 -march=k8 -mtune=k8 -mmmx -msse -msse2 -msse3 -pipe \
-minline-all-stringops -s
CPPFLAGS=${CFLAGS}
CXXFLAGS=${CFLAGS}

собиралась "dmidecode".
порты новые.
Нагуглить не получилось.
Кстати, при сборке других портов в сообщениях компиляции было видно, что CFLAGS в двух местах, другие порты собирались без ошибок.
Из- за чего это может быть? Я в других местах, кроме make.conf, CFLAGS не выставлял.
Система почти чистая(недавно поставил и начал установку из портов с такими флагами оптимизации).

2

Так, никто не отвечает, пора закрывать тему, тем более, что я не дождался ответа и нашел причину сам, вкратце:
Для CPPFLAGS и CXXFLAGS надо указывать точно так-же, как и в CFLAGS(просто в makefile- е порта было указано, что CPPFLAGS равен ${CFLAGS}, а у меня CPPFLAGS был равен ${CFLAGS}, вот и рекурсивный CFLAGS из- за чего и ошибка).